In the heart of America’s booming energy landscape, Permian Resources Corporation (NYSE:PR) is making waves as a prime player in oil and natural gas production. With the U.S. already reigniting its oil output — now over 13.45 million barrels per day — Permian Resources is strategically positioned for growth. Amidst fluctuating prices and market shifts, the company reported stellar results in Q3 2024, boasting an impressive 161,000 barrels of oil produced daily.
But what sets Permian Resources apart? After its recent $818 million acquisition, the company expanded its reach in the Permian Basin, enhancing its operational capacity and driving down production costs. With a sharp 150% dividend hike, yielding 4.97%, it’s clear that this oil giant prioritizes rewarding its shareholders.
As the energy sector grapples with volatility—going from gains of over 6% to losses nearing 10%—Permian’s dividends represent a beacon of stability. Industry experts forecast a tougher road ahead for major oil players, with expected drops in crude prices over the next few years. Yet, Permian’s innovative operational efficiencies and strategic acquisitions reflect a resilience that can weather these storms.

Unveiling the Future of Energy: Permian Resources Corporation’s Strategic Moves
When it comes to the evolving landscape of the energy sector, Permian Resources Corporation (NYSE: PR) is not only keeping pace but is also leading the way in the oil and natural gas market. As the U.S. boosts its oil output to over 13.45 million barrels per day, Permian Resources is strategically positioned to capitalize on growth opportunities. Here’s a more comprehensive look at the company and what investors need to know.
Key Features and Innovations
1. Operational Growth: Following its recent $818 million acquisition, Permian Resources has significantly enhanced its production capacity in the Permian Basin. This move not only increases output but also allows for lower production costs, making the company more competitive in a volatile market.
2. Dividend Policy: The company’s decision to hike its dividend by 150%, resulting in a yield of 4.97%, emphasizes its commitment to return value to shareholders despite market uncertainties. This is especially significant in an environment where many companies may cut dividends to conserve cash.
3. Technological Advancements: Permian Resources is leveraging new technologies to improve operational efficiencies, which is vital for maintaining profitability as crude prices fluctuate. Use of advanced drilling technologies and data analytics for resource management further boosts their competitive edge.
Limitations and Challenges
– Market Volatility: Despite its strong positioning, Permian must navigate the volatile oil prices, which are forecasted to decline in the coming years. The company’s financial health will depend on its ability to maintain low operational costs and continue efficient production.
– Environmental Concerns: As energy production increasingly faces scrutiny regarding environmental impacts, Permian must also address issues related to sustainability and regulatory compliance. Innovations in sustainable practices will be crucial for long-term resilience.
Pricing Trends and Market Insights
Industry analysts predict that while oil prices may dip, the increasing demand for energy, especially from developing nations, will balance out the fluctuations. Permian Resources is well-positioned to benefit from this increased demand due to its robust operational capabilities.
